Vision for Education are working with a school in Portishead to recruit a friendly and enthusiastic Teaching Assistant, to start as soon as possible. Working on a full-time basis, the school welcomes applications from both newly qualified and more experienced teaching assistants.
The role
The school are looking for a creative and hardworking Teaching Assistant, ideally with experience of working with both Key Stage 1 and 2 (KS1/2) children. Supporting the class teacher to maintain a fun and engaging learning environment, this a varied role that will include full class support, small group interventions and occasional 1-to-1 work as required.

Requirements
To be considered for the Teaching Assistant position, you will:
• Have experience working in both Key Stage1 and 2 (KS1/2)
• Hold a minimum Level 2 childcare qualification
• Have excellent behaviour management skills
• Be a confident communicator, able to use your own initiative when required
Vision for Education is committed to safeguarding children, young people and vulnerable adults. We take our responsibilities extremely seriously. All staff we register will undertake thorough interviewing and referencing checks and hold, or be prepared to undergo, an Enhanced DBS check that must be registered on the Update Service.
